Bracket clock, wooden case with round dial on square plinth, cast brass bezel, movement with star wheel and rack striking - repeating on a single gong, ebonised drum head case supported by two scroll hands on a rectangular base with brass inlay and pad feet, shaped rear door has metal fret and is lined with silk, white dial with Roman numerals, two winding holes, scroll feature below dial, back has mesh in circular pattern. The clock makers are Jacobs & Lucas, Hull. Bethel Jacobs was a watch and clockmaker at 7 Whitefriargate, Hull between 1838-1872. He developed a partnership as Jacobs & Lucas from 1851 to 1858. In the latter part of July 1863 he erected an electrical time ball in front of his shop for the benefit of sea captains.
